Laughter: A Social Behavior

Laughter is a social behavior that makes sense when done in a group. Studies show that we laugh 30 times more often in social settings than when we're alone. Watching stand-up comedy or certain movies alone is not as funny compared to when we watch them with friends. Laughter is a social way of initiating play with each other.
